Hanspur Population - Azamgarh, Uttar Pradesh

Hanspur is a medium size village located in Sagri Tehsil of Azamgarh district, Uttar Pradesh with total 111 families residing. The Hanspur village has population of 766 of which 390 are males while 376 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Hanspur village population of children with age 0-6 is 115 which makes up 15.01 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hanspur village is 964 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Hanspur as per census is 1091,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Hanspur village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Hanspur village was 63.44 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Hanspur Male literacy stands at 74.03 % while female literacy rate was 52.22 %.

Caste Factor

In Hanspur village, most of the villagers are from Schedule Caste (SC).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 48.30 % of total population in Hanspur village. The village Hanspur curr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Hanspur village out of total population, 194 were engaged in work activities. 43.30 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 56.70 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 194 workers engaged in Main Work, 19 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 34 were Agricultural labourer.
